Don't Toy with Me, Miss Nagatoro

Review of Don't Toy with Me, Miss Nagatoro

7/10

Story: The story was good with some decent developments. I enjoyed seeing the jealous sides of both Nagatoro and Naoto Hachioji. It leaves for interesting developments to the love side of the story. The format to this show is more like repeated little short stories with the underlying love story that continues throughout the show overall a good enjoyable story. Art: The art is pretty decent, nothing crazy or anything and someone pointed out to me that they like to just make everything very reflective which is somewhat true. Nothing too crazy for the animation side of things but non the less a well goodanimated series.

Sounds: The opening for this anime is really good, I love the animation they used for it, and the song itself is also really good. Not the biggest fan of the outro but it's still good, just not my cup of tea.

Characters: The main character is not for everybody, he is pretty annoying. He's your classic anime loser but he’s not bad, and there is no other personality that would work for a story like this. The side cast is pretty good, nothing too crazy, Miss Nagatoro is great, and the president is also pretty good with her serious personality. Introducing different personalities in the mix is what keeps a story refreshing, so she was a good addition.

Enjoyment: This show is one of those entertaining show that isn't that good if that makes sense; it's not a berserk or one piece, it's just a short and sweet it’s a show that leaves you feeling satisfied, and fulfilled another thing that I realized is that there's a lot of cringe moment in this show, and I kept clicking pause, but I always enjoyed the outcome of those cringey moments. Overall a very enjoyable show, just don't take it too seriously.
